Exploring Colombo: Your Guide to Ride & Taxi Services

Wiki Article

Getting around Colombo is easier than you might think, particularly with the abundance of ride services. You’ll find a mix of metered cabs and app-based services like PickMe and Uber. Regular metered cars are typically readily found near hotels, major sights, and busy areas. However, negotiating for a fair price is occasionally necessary. For a more predictable cost, consider using app-based ride hailing platforms; these usually offer fixed pricing and the ability to track your driver. Always verify the estimated fare before commencing your trip!

Finding a Taxi in Sri Lanka: What You Need to Know

Securing a taxi in Sri Lanka can be simple, but knowing the typical practices is essential. You'll usually find taxis waiting at airports or can order one from your guesthouse. Agreeing on a price beforehand is vital, as fixed rates are rarely used, especially outside big cities. Be ready to bargain a bit; a pleasant attitude will often enhance your odds of getting a good deal. Alternatively, online taxi platforms like PickMe are available, offering convenience and usually more consistent pricing – though they might aren’t accessible nationwide. Remember to check the operator's credentials and look for potential scams.
